Hudson Technologies, Inc. (HDSN)
NASDAQ: HDSN · Real-Time Price · USD
6.03
+0.12 (2.03%)
Nov 21, 2024, 4:00 PM EST - Market closed

Hudson Technologies Ratios and Metrics

Millions USD.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2023 FY 2022 FY 2021 FY 2020 FY 2019 2018 - 2014
Period Ending
Nov '24 Dec '23 Dec '22 Dec '21 Dec '20 Dec '19 2018 - 2014
Market Capitalization
2736144561954742
Upgrade
Market Cap Growth
-37.12%34.56%133.66%313.18%13.39%9.91%
Upgrade
Enterprise Value
221622503279131148
Upgrade
Last Close Price
6.0313.4910.124.441.090.98
Upgrade
PE Ratio
9.2811.754.396.05--
Upgrade
Forward PE
15.0810.588.5516.75--
Upgrade
PS Ratio
1.112.121.401.010.320.26
Upgrade
PB Ratio
1.072.682.612.751.160.92
Upgrade
P/TBV Ratio
2.153.694.1770.25--
Upgrade
P/FCF Ratio
3.3611.177.71-4.621.27
Upgrade
P/OCF Ratio
3.1610.487.26-4.041.23
Upgrade
PEG Ratio
0.550.380.310.67--
Upgrade
EV/Sales Ratio
0.902.151.551.450.890.91
Upgrade
EV/EBITDA Ratio
5.107.413.665.7510.93-
Upgrade
EV/EBIT Ratio
5.947.963.836.5922.22-
Upgrade
EV/FCF Ratio
2.7311.328.50-12.844.51
Upgrade
Debt / Equity Ratio
0.020.030.291.412.312.37
Upgrade
Debt / EBITDA Ratio
0.120.080.361.946.26-
Upgrade
Debt / FCF Ratio
0.070.120.86-9.193.26
Upgrade
Asset Turnover
0.821.021.331.020.860.79
Upgrade
Inventory Turnover
1.431.181.361.752.161.80
Upgrade
Quick Ratio
1.900.740.500.270.300.23
Upgrade
Current Ratio
4.373.503.361.861.651.61
Upgrade
Return on Equity (ROE)
12.91%25.89%84.45%57.83%-12.15%-45.38%
Upgrade
Return on Assets (ROA)
7.76%17.17%33.67%14.01%2.16%-4.83%
Upgrade
Return on Capital (ROIC)
9.40%21.20%41.43%17.30%2.57%-5.62%
Upgrade
Earnings Yield
11.34%8.51%22.75%16.52%-11.02%-62.25%
Upgrade
FCF Yield
29.73%8.95%12.97%-1.61%21.62%78.74%
Upgrade
Buyback Yield / Dilution
0.00%-0.49%-1.00%-9.20%-0.23%-0.30%
Upgrade
Total Shareholder Return
0.00%-0.49%-1.00%-9.20%-0.23%-0.30%
Upgrade
Source: S&P Capital IQ. Standard template. Financial Sources.